    Olympus Pin Tumbler Cam Lock, DCN2 7/8" Material Thickness with 3/4" Cylinder, Bright Brass, Keyed Alike - 107

    • Technical data, DCN2-US3-107
      Technical data, DCN2-US3-107

    Description

    Olympus Pin Tumbler Cam Lock For Cabinet Security

    Olympus pin tumbler cam lock gives cabinets and enclosures a keyed control point using a zinc die cast body and cylinder, creating a compact locking solution that suits many woodworking and casework builds. The bright brass finish (US3) provides a traditional metal appearance that visually matches other bright brass fittings in a run of doors or drawers. The N Series keyway, equivalent to National D4291 4-pin or D4292 5-pin systems, keeps this lock aligned with a familiar commercial key system that installers encounter in many shops and facilities. The lock is keyed alike to KA107, so multiple DCN2-US3-107 units can share the same key number for straightforward key management on a project. The pin tumbler cylinder design supports standard pinning practices, so locksmiths and hardware techs can integrate this lock into an existing N Series key plan while retaining consistent operation and feel.

    Key Olympus Cam Lock Details That Drive Performance

    • The zinc die cast body and zinc die cast pin tumbler cylinder create a solid metal housing that stands up to repeated key cycles in cabinet doors and drawers, which matters on high-traffic millwork where hardware sees constant daily use.
    • The lock has passed ANSI/BHMA A156.11 Grade 1 performance requirements, equivalent to E07261 and E07271, which signals a tested cam lock suitable for demanding commercial environments where long service life under load is important.
    • The key removable in locked or unlocked position standard function allows users to remove the key after securing or accessing a cabinet, which simplifies key use patterns where staff expect the key to be pocketed regardless of cam position.
    • Two reversible cams that work in all positions provide flexibility in how the cam engages strikes or frames, so installers can adapt the rotation and throw to different door or panel layouts without changing the core lock body.
    • The 1 inch face that covers splintering eliminates the need for an additional trim ring, which helps clean up slightly rough or chipped bore edges in wood panels and saves a step during cabinet retrofits or new installations.
    • Stock keying options of KD/KA 4 pin standard with stock KA numbers 101, 103, 107, and 915, plus 5 pin masterkeyed and grand masterkeyed capability, give locksmiths structured choices for grouping locks while maintaining hierarchy in larger key systems.

    Cam Lock Installation And Cylinder Rekey Workflow

    The DCN2 7/8 inch material thickness design with 3/4 inch cylinder length is built for panels in that thickness range, so cabinetmakers can drill standard cam lock bores in common casework materials and expect the cylinder to sit correctly. The 1 inch face diameter covers the edge of the hole, hiding minor tear-out that can occur when drilling through veneer or laminate on plywood and particleboard. The lock is easily rekeyable via a cylinder retainer clip, which allows a technician to change keying without replacing the entire lock body, helping preserve face alignment and cam setup during key system changes. The N Series keyway ties this lock into a broadly used commercial key family, so service personnel familiar with National D4291 or D4292 patterns can pin and maintain these cylinders with standard tooling.

    Common Questions About This Olympus Cam Lock

    What key system does the Olympus pin tumbler cam lock use?

    The Olympus pin tumbler cam lock uses an N Series keyway, equivalent to the National D4291 4-pin or D4292 5-pin system, which aligns it with a widely used commercial key family.

    How is the DCN2-US3-107 cam lock rekeyed in the field?

    The DCN2-US3-107 cam lock is easily rekeyable via a cylinder retainer clip, allowing changes in keying while retaining the existing lock body and cam setup on the cabinet.

    What panel thickness is this bright brass cam lock designed for?

    This bright brass cam lock is a DCN2 7/8 inch material thickness model with a 3/4 inch cylinder, matching installations where the panel falls within that material thickness range.

    Does this cam lock support masterkey and grand master systems?

    The Olympus pin tumbler cam lock is 5 pin masterkeyed standard and can be grand masterkeyed, enabling it to function within tiered key systems in larger facilities.

    What does ANSI BHMA Grade 1 performance mean for this lock?

    The cam lock has passed ANSI/BHMA A156.11 Grade 1 performance requirements, equivalent to E07261 and E07271, indicating it is tested for demanding usage conditions.

    Can the key be removed when the cabinet is unlocked?

    The standard function allows the key to be removable in locked or unlocked position, so users can remove the key after opening or securing the cabinet without changing habits.
